بندراهامالر برا زبان فوق العاده Xbase. | |
انون بارر ن |
بندراه رتبه بند و خلاصه
تبلغات
بندراه برسب ها
بندراه شرح
امالر برا زبان سورست خانواده xBase. بندر امالر برا زبان سورست خانواده xBase اغلب به عنوان ر (زبان است ه توسط امالر CA-ر اجرا) اشاره شده است. ان امالر لت فرم متقابل و شناخته شده است به امال و اجرا بر رو MS-DOS، MS-وندوز (32،64)، اموتر ها جب، وندوز CE، OS / 2، نو / لنوس و م OSX.Why با استفاده از آن به ان دلل است؟ نرم افزار راان 100 سازار با ر compilersBecause حذف برخ از محدودت ها اعمال شده اجرا اه اما دامنه ان ار در خود را انتخاب platform.Because هاربر بست دارد اثبات شده است به ثبات، قو و efficient.Because هاربر از RDDs (ااه تعوض رانندان) اجازه م دهد از منابع اطلاعات متعدد ه اجازه م دهد برنامه به scale.Because هاربر قابل حمل در سراسر سستم عامل ها متعدد را با همان د معمار base.Because هاربر به طور امل باز است و شتبان از افزودن شخص ثالث در market.Because هاربر منبع باز است و لذا شما هم نه در رحمت از تصممات company.Because بندر خصوص توسط تم بسار با تجربه و قادر به developers.Most توسعه مهمتر، سع ند هاربر برا خودتان، برا خودتان تصمم برد ه را آن را دارا مزاا برا you.Th است محصول خواهد بود بندر دستاه ها مننه زن ه جدد در ان نسخه: دجتال مار C ساخت ثابت شده است. دبان، RPM بسته بند رفع. شرفت ندن فت د، رفع هشدار دهنده. رفع فت فلم ارردان تهه ننده، قالب بند. ثابت به طور ه PRG_USR ساخت زمان همشه لغو زنه ها ش فرض در نو-را. مورد ناز بسته او لنوس به توضحات / linux1st.txt. زنه ها امالر ها غر ضرور و وابست معاونت تمز از فرآندها ساخت. دارون ثابت (OS X) م سازد به علت تغر مدت وتاه قبل از 1.0.0 شسته. نام فال وشش غر حساس اساز مربوط م شود. اراتر غر ASCII از ندن فال منبع برا بهبود قابلت حمل ساده. او RDD د آزمون ررسون. ثابت سررز بافر بالقوه در PP، GTCRS، GTPCA، GTSTD، hbfbird، hbwhat32. حذف باق مانده غر امن تماس دستار رشته: strncpy به ()، strcpy به () -> hb_strncpy () strncat ()، strcat () -> hb_strncat () برخ از برخورد نام contrib را ثابت در غر GNU م سازد. gtalleg GT به منطقه contrib را منتقل به آن را فعال برا غر GNU م سازد و در * nix غر سازد به طور ل. استفاده از HB_INC_ALLEGRO ا HB_DIR_ALLEGRO (برا غر GNU را تنها) برا مشخص ردن محل از هدر و ا بسته بند شده (به ترتب). امالر بندر در حال حاضر به طور ش فرض سوئ -gc0 (-gc2 بود) برا تولد وترن خروج ج ممن به طور ش فرض. ثابت به تحت برنامه Cygwin امال. زنه -mno-از Cygwin از MinGW حذف م سازد. شما ممن است ناز به readd ان به C_USR ار شما استفاده از امالر MinGW بسار قدم مانند ماان MinGW322.95. ثابت لرزاندن و تان دادن نسل harbour.dll در غر GNU م سازد. ثابت لرزاندن و تان دادن هشدارها ساخت در غر GNU م سازد. زنه ها همام ساز شده ساخت بن را BCC / MSVC نو و غر GNU را. مقدار ش فرض envvar HB_VISUALC_VER نواخت به 80 برا هر دو هسته ا و contrib و لرزاندن و تان دادن ساخت در غر GNU را تغر داده است. شما ممن است ناز محط زست خود را ار شما به طور ش فرض ته تغر دهد. غر GNU MSVC لرزاندن و تان دادن م سازد در حال حاضر به جران اصل غر GNU MSVC را اره شده است. make_vcce.bat برداشته شد. لطفا دستورالعمل make_vc.bat، ونه برا شروع ساخت لرزاندن و تان دادن به عنوان خوانده شده. در حال حاضر بندر قادر به ساخت و اجرا صحح در حالت MSVC C در AMD64 (64 بت) حالت است. اضافه شدن تجرب Pelles C لرزاندن و تان دادن فال GNU-را. ان ار هنوز به درست ار نم ند. ارسال فال دسته ا به نام از فال ها را غر GNU هسته تغر نام داد، لطفا به روز رسان سستم خود را ار شما در حال استفاده از آنها: exit_err.bat -> hbmkpost.bat اضافه شدن تجرب MSVC لرزاندن و تان دادن فال GNU-را. او دارون خودار به غر GNU شهناز فال را. تغر نام نو-را از MinGW لرزاندن و تان دادن امالر (HB_COMPILER) از 'cemgw' به 'mingwce. لطفا سستم شما به روز رسان، ار شما با استفاده از ان به طور مستقم (و نه از طرق make_ * اسرت ce.sh). آمار ماول حافظه حاضر به صورت شفرض برا عملرد مطلوب تبدل شده است. م توان آن را در با تنظم HB_FM_STATISTICS لان تبدل شده است. او HB_LEGACY_LEVEL لان به نجاندن نترل برخ از عناصر هاربر، توصه نمشود. ان مارو به طور ش فرض فعال است، و غر فعال خواهد شد (و قطعات مراث احتمالا حذف) در Harbor 1.1. انون متواند آن را با #defining HB_LEGACY_LEVEL_OFF غر فعال ردن دست، به منظور بررس آنه عناصر ناز به تغر، و ار از آنها به درست و به طور امل در د محل شما تغر شد. HB_DBG _ * () توابع داخل به داخل تابع فضا نام __DBG * نقل مان رد (). بعض از انها به طور بالقوه توسط بسته ها 3 حزب استفاده هنوز هم تحت نام قدم در دسترس هستند، هنام ه HB_LEGACY_LEVEL # تعرف شده است. حذف __VM قدم * () ماروها ه به __DBG * () توابع مستعار شد. مارو __EXPORT__ تغر نام -> HB_DYNLIB ان به طور معمول باد اربران را تحت تاثر قرار، اما ار شما اتفاق م افتد به استفاده از آن، لطفا آن را به روز رسان. برخ از نام ها لان داخل تغر شرح زر است:. OS_UNIX_COMPATIBLE * -> HB_OS_UNIX_COMPATIBLE OS_DOS_COMPATIBLE -> تعرف شده (HB_OS_UNIX_COMPATIBLE) OS_PATH_LIST_SEPARATOR -> HB_OS_PATH_LIST_SEP_CHR OS_PATH_DELIMITER * -> HB_OS_PATH_DELIM_CHR OS_PATH_DELIMITER_STRING -> HB_OS_PATH_DELIM_STR OS_PATH_DELIMITER_LIST -> HB_OS_PATH_DELIM_LIST OS_FILE_MASK -> HB_OS_ALLFILE_MASK OS_DRIVE_DELIMITER -> HB_OS_DRIVE_DELIM_CHR OS_HAS_DRIVE_LETTER -> HB_OS_HAS_DRIVE_LETTER OS_OPT_DELIMITER_LIST -> HB_OS_OPT_DELIM_LIST OS_EOL_LEN -> HB_OS_EOL_LEN HARBOUR_GCC_OS2 -> HB_OS_OS2_GCC HARBOUR_START_PROCEDURE -> HB_START_PROCEDURE HARBOUR_MAIN_STD -> HB_MAIN_STD HARBOUR_MAIN_WIN -> HB_MAIN_WIN HARBOUR_MAX_RDD_DRIVERNAME_LENGTH * -> HB_RDD_MAX_DRIVERNAME_LEN HARBOUR_MAX_RDD_ALIAS_LENGTH * -> HB_RDD_MAX_ALIAS_LEN HARBOUR_MAX_RDD_AREA_NUM -> HB_RDD_MAX_AREA_NUM ار شما اتفاق م افتد به استفاده از ان، لطفا به روز رسان د شما به استفاده از نام ها جدد. آنها ه معمولا استفاده م شود (مشخص شده با '*') هنوز هم تحت نام قدم، وشش داده شده با HB_LEGACY_LEVEL در دسترس هستند. hbmake و hbdoc ابزار اهش در اندازه، ند رفع، شتبان multiplaform بهتر و تعداد زاد از اساز د، به خصوص در hbmake (هنوز هم راه طولان برا رفتن هر ند). برخ از نام ها بد دانسته و جازن با امانات جدد: FHANDLE -> HB_FHANDLE EVALINFO -> HB_EVALINFO PEVALINFO -> PHB_EVALINFO EVALINFO_PTR -> به جا مشخص شده به عنوان مراث، استفاده PHB_EVALINFO. CLR_STRLEN -> HB_CLRSTR_LEN همه ان ها با HB_LEGACY_LEVEL مشخص شده اند. مهم توجه داشته باشد ه مراث ر منابع C سازار ممن است همنان به استفاده از ر علامت سازار، بدون توجه به تنظم HB_LEGACY_LEVEL است. ان توصه برا تغر ان به بندر-تنها منابع C در آماده ساز به نسخه اصل هاربر بعد (1.1). مشخص hb_fileNameConv () به عنوان HB_LEGACY_LEVEL. حزب و برنامه توسعه دهندان 3 باد به hb_fsNameConv تغر دهد (). GTI_ *، GFX_ * ماروها مشخص شده به عنوان HB_LEGACY_LEVEL. لطفا برا استفاده از HB_GTI_ *، HB_GFX_ * معادل. ثابت تاخت و تاز ردن بافر بالقوه در hb_fsTempName (). ان مدت وتاه قبل از 1.0.0 آشنا شدم. دبار: نوار نام تابع از نام ماول برا مقدارده اوله متغر سترده جهان و فال. ان رفع ارائه فال متغرها سراسر استات در دبار. حذف hb_hInstance، hb_hPrevInstance، s_iCmdShow، s_WinMainParam قدم متغرها عموم مستند نشده. احزاب 3 باد API رسم hb_winmainArgGet () برا به دست آوردن ان مقادر استفاده ند. ان و نز وابسته HB_LEGACY_LEVEL، بنابران آن را در 1.1 نها، تا آن زمان، علامت ها قدم هنوز هم ار م نند. _FIELD ثابت به طور غر مستقم به عنوان نام مستعار برا تولد RTE راست استفاده م شود:؟ ( "_FIELD") -> نام، و ا: M-> ور: = "_FIELD"؛ ؟ ( "ور") -> NAME سستم عامل ثابت () برا تشخص وستا / وندوز 2008. ان اشال در 1.0.0rc2 آشنا شدم. سستم عامل ثابت () رشته زمان ه بر رو وندوز XP اجرا نسخه 64 بت. تغر HB_COMPILER () ه همشه 32/64 بت در رشته بازشت را نشان م دهد. GPFs و نشت ثابت در هنام استفاده امالر هاربر سوئ -w3. بد برا Pelles C 5.00.1 در حالت AMD64 به امال بندراه، INET، زر سستم اضافه شده ا. آن را نم خواهد به درست ار مند، اما اجازه م دهد تا ساختن بقه هاربر (مانند hbrun.exe). معاونت PCRE به روز رسان به 7.8 (از 7.7) ثابت dbInfo (DBI_POSITIONED) مقدار برشت. خطا داخل ثابت در خواندن شاخص ثف. مقدار بازشت ثابت از HB_INETGETSNDBUFSIZE (). GPF ثابت زمان ه بلو د مرتب ساز بر اربران به اندازه آراه مرتب شده را اهش م دهد. تا ثابت در د هش شبه ساز ه باعث شده است ه ارجاع به آراه لون شود. با تشر مندواس به عنوان مثال. اضافه شدن ام از دست رفته
بندراه نرم افزارها مرتبط
rubyscript2exe
RubyScript2EXE اسرت روب خود را به نسخه مستقل، فشرده ساز، لنوس ا Mac OS X (دارون) تبدل م ند. ...
195